13.40K 浏览2021/06/23性能问题 0 huanxuan16320 2021/06/21 0条评论 我们在做压测的时候把数据压倒了800万,让后发现,查询很慢,一查发现是它走的是错误的索引,这很奇怪,明明查询条件都没有改变,然后我把那个正确的索引删除,然后再重新创建一遍(一模一样)发现他又走这条正确的索引了,查询又恢复了,这把我搞懵了,这到底是怎么回事?为何重新创建后,他又走了正确的索引? xiaoxu 已回答的问题 2021/06/23 2 答案 活跃已投票最新最老的 0 xiaoxu1.13K 发布 2021/06/23 0 条评论 重新创建相当于要重新解析语句。另外存在一些冗余索引导致MongoDB选错的执行计划。 xiaoxu 已回答的问题 2021/06/23 您正在查看2个答案中的1个,单击此处查看所有答案。 注册 或 登录